Pd4S8 is a palladium sulfide compound semiconductor with a layered crystal structure, belonging to the family of transition metal chalcogenides. This material is primarily of research interest for optoelectronic and thermoelectric applications, where its semiconductor properties and high bulk modulus could be exploited in next-generation devices; it remains largely experimental rather than widely commercialized, but represents a promising platform in the broader class of noble-metal chalcogenides being investigated for photovoltaics, photodetectors, and catalytic applications where palladium's chemical inertness combined with sulfide semiconductivity offers unique advantages.
